Use of an SDN Switch in Support of NIST ICS Security Recommendations and Least Privilege Networking

If an attacker is able to successfully subvert a device within a network, that often gives them easier access to spread the intrusion to other devices in the network. Common guidance, such as that provided in NIST SP 800-82, recommends network separation and segregation to enforce least privilege within a network, to act as a mitigation against such attacks. This paper evaluates the use of SDN network switches to implement least privilege networking within an industrial control system, and maps SDN switch capabilities to NIST 800-82 recommendations and the corresponding NIST 800-53 security controls. This paper also reports on experiments conducted with two SDN switches to validate the effectiveness of the switches in support of these mappings. Our findings indicate that with appropriate planning, several aspects of least privilege networking, and several of the NIST controls can be implemented with an SDN switch. However, poor configurations can still result in insecure systems.
